VPN in clouds

VPN is very important part of security. I prepared a set of script, so it is easy to run your own VPN server on VPS.

The scripts are available in my Cloud Tunnels respository.

There are 3 types of technologies:

  • IKEv2 VPN with StrongSwan and Let’s Encrypt certificate (the best option)
  • L2TP VPN server with LibreSwan
  • Squid Proxy – it is not VPN, but it can be usefull

Every scripts has 2 variants:

  • cloud init script
  • shell script

If your VPS provider supports cloud init, the installation of VPN server can be totally unattended. You can run cloud init scripts in Amazon AWS, DigitalOcean or Vultr for example. All scripts assume Centos 7.
